two.1.4) Short description

TEFOS - “Territorios Forestales Sostenibles” - is a £64m bilateral forest programme that aims to stabilise the deforestation frontier in conflict-affected areas of rural Colombia. TEFOS is based on three key, complimentary actions: i) improving and updating information for sustainable land use management, ii) strengthening institutions in charge of establishing an environmental rule of law and iii) supporting sustainable livelihoods.

TEFOS Pillar 3 is focused on kick starting and improving livelihoods in prioritised deforestation hotspots, through: 

- Increasing communities’ skills and knowledge of sustainable agricultural practices and sustainable forest management to protect and increase forest cover. 

- Promoting commercialisation and improving market access for sustainable commodities and services through public-private partnerships that protect standing forests in the deforestation border.  

- Promoting conservation incentives in areas with land use restrictions.
